ETABS (Extended ThreeDimensional Analysis of Building Systems) is a popular software used for structural analysis and design, including seismic analysis. Here's a breakdown of seismic analysis using ETABS:

Importance of Seismic Analysis:

Earthquakes generate lateral forces that can cause significant damage or collapse of structures.

Seismic analysis helps engineers evaluate a structure's ability to withstand these forces.

ETABS allows for modeling the structure, defining seismic loads, and analyzing the response.

Creation: Define the geometry of the structure, including beams, columns, walls, slabs, etc.

Material Properties: Specify the materials used in the structure, which affects its seismic response.

Seismic Load Definition: Define seismic loads based on building code requirements and site location.

Analysis Options: Choose static or dynamic analysis methods to simulate earthquake effects.

Analysis Results: View results like member forces, displacements, story drifts, and base shear.
